Brisbane: The first T20 of three-match series between Pakistan and Australia will be played at Brisbane tomorrow.
The match will start at 1:00 pm Pakistan standard time.
Pakistan and Australia’s last bilateral face-off in the T20I format came in March 2022 when the two teams played a one-off T20I in Lahore which Australia won. In Pakistan’s last T20I series in Australia in November 2019, the hosts won 2-0 after the opening game ended up as no result.
Josh Inglis will lead Australia in the T20I series while Tim David and Nathan Ellis have joined Australia’s T20I squad. Josh Philippe has replaced injured Cooper Connolly.
Earlier, Pakistan won the three-match One Day International series against Australia.
